The North Glenmore Sector Study is one of the largest planning initiatives undertaken in the Okanagan and will guide the long-term, phased development of complete, walkable neighbourhoods. The study is anticipated to establish a planning + policy framework for a 30–50 year buildout alongside parks, trails, schools, community facilities, neighbourhood shops, protected environmental areas, and active farmland. 

Placemark is working with the City of Kelowna in leading the North Glenmore Sector Study, responding to employment growth and the need for family-oriented housing near this economic hub. Working closely with City staff, Placemark prepared the Terms of Reference and led a multidisciplinary consulting team through technical analysis and the development of neighbourhood design options with varying housing mixes and infrastructure needs. Placemark continues to collaborate with City staff to identify a preferred option for detailed technical evaluation, while leading ongoing landowner and stakeholder engagement.
